這篇文章主要介紹了關于wampserver+phpstorm+xdebug環境配置調試php代碼,有著一定的參考價值,現在分享給大家,有需要的朋友可以參考一下
wampserver+phpstorm+xdebug環境配置調試php代碼wampserver安裝
phpstorm安裝
xdebug安裝
phpstorm下調試
phpstorm安裝wampserver安裝比較簡單,只需要下載wampserver.exe,一路next下去即可
xdebug安裝phpstorm下載地址:https://www.jetbrains.com/phpstorm/
phpstorm破解方法:http://www.oyksoft.com/soft/40722.html?pc=1
在安裝完成之后,如果phpstorm還是沒有正確破解,看看是不是你的host文件是否有將 0.0.0.0 account.jetbrains.com 添加進去,具體host文件存儲位置為:C:/Windows/System32/drivers/etc
默認情況下,如果你安裝的是wampserver,xdebug插件是默認裝好的,具體xdebug安裝路徑可以通過查看php.ini找到,尋找方法是左鍵點擊wampserver程序圖標,找到PHP選項,找到php.ini,點擊進去,搜索[xdebug],其中zend_extension的值就是你的xdebug存儲位置,為了能夠在phpstorm中調試php代碼,我們需要在php.ini的[xdebug]標簽最后面添加下面代碼:
zend_extension ="E:/StudySoftware/wampserver/wamp/bin/php/php5.6.25/zend_ext/php_xdebug-2.4.1-5.6-vc11.dll"xdebug.remote_enable = 1xdebug.profiler_enable = offxdebug.profiler_enable_trigger = Offxdebug.profiler_output_name = cachegrind.out.%t.%pxdebug.profiler_output_dir ="E:/StudySoftware/wampserver/wamp/tmp"xdebug.show_local_vars=0xdebug.idekey=PhpStorm xdebug.remote_enable = On xdebug.remote_host=localhost xdebug.remote_port=9000 xdebug.remote_handler=dbgp
谷歌瀏覽器下安裝Xdebug插件配置完成后重啟wampserver即可,接著在瀏覽器中輸入localhost,找到phpinfo,點擊進去,搜索xdebug,找到下面內容:
phpstorm調試配置下載地址:http://www.downza.cn/soft/211550.html
下載完成之后,點擊右上角的蜘蛛圖標,選擇選項,在里面輸入如下圖所示的內容
phpstorm進行調試(1):File->Settings->Languages&Frame Works->Php->Servers 配置服務器相關設置,配置內容如下圖所示
(2):File->Settings->Languages&Frame Works->Php->Debug->DBGp Proxy 配置相關設置,配置內容如下圖所示:
(3):File->Settings->Languages&Frame Works->Php-Debug 找到右邊窗口對應的debug設置,把端口改成9000,配置內容如下圖所示:
參考文獻(1):在谷歌瀏覽器中輸入:http://localhost/startwill/index.php,當然這個地址你自己隨便變
(2):點擊谷歌瀏覽器中的xdebug插件,選擇Debug選項
(3):在phpstorm中打開一個我們自己的php文件,在這里我的是index.php文件,設置一個斷點,點擊右上角的調試按鈕:
(4):在瀏覽器中按下回車鍵之后,就會執行到我們設置的斷點處啦
http://developer.51cto.com/art/201704/536857.htm
以上就是wampserver+phpstorm+xdebug環境配置調試php代碼的詳細內容,更多請關注 其它相關文章!
鄭重聲明:本文版權歸原作者所有,轉載文章僅為傳播更多信息之目的,如作者信息標記有誤,請第一時間聯系我們修改或刪除,多謝。
新聞熱點
疑難解答